White Lake is a 19 MW oil power plant in New Hampshire, United States of America. It is operated by Granite Shore Power. Based on reported annual generation of 0 GWh, it can supply roughly 57 homes. It ranks #3913 of 9,833 United States of America power plants by installed capacity. Commissioned in 1968, it is around 58 years old — an older, legacy facility. Its measured emissions of 12,216 t CO₂/yr (Climate TRACE) are equivalent to about 2,848 cars driven for a year. In context, oil supplies about 0.7% of United States of America's electricity; the national grid averages 384 gCO₂/kWh (43.0% low-carbon) (2025).
